Leading to the cathedral, Rua Senador Feijó is lined in university bookshops and snack shops (lanchonetes). At the end of a palm tree-lined alley, you will see the somewhat drab, neo-Gothic façade of Sé Cathedral (1954). And yet it hides an impressive interior, in terms of its size (111m long) and the scale of the vertical lines created by its pillars, without forgetting the exquisite, colourful stained-glass windows filtering the light. The building can hold up to 8 000 people.
